#64ae10 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#64ae10 is composed of 39.2% red, 68.2%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.8%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 88.1 degrees, a saturation of 83.2% and a lightness of 37.3%. #64ae10 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ff20 with #005d00.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#64ae10 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#64ae10 has RGB values of R:100, G:174,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 6598160.
